Dell Urich - Randolph Golf Complex is a 18-hole golf course in Tucson, Arizona, playing to a par 70 at 6,663 yards from the back tees. The course opened in 1961 and was designed by William F. Bell. Greens are bermuda grass and fairways are bermuda grass.

What golfers love
Golfers tell us that this golf course in Tucson is the all-around best. They praise the great elevations, beautiful course, and the variety of holes, distance, and scenery. Despite some restroom facilities needing remodeling, the overall experience is considered great. The course conditions are consistently good, considering the number of rounds played on it. Some golfers express the need for an initiative to encourage repairing ball marks on the greens. Nonetheless, they appreciate the management's efforts and find the experience enjoyable. After a reseed, the course is in great shape, with super nice tee boxes and greens. Although there are mentions of carts stalling, golfers still have a great time. The greens are recovering from aeration, which affects putting, but overall the course is in good condition. Despite the heat, it is recommended that everyone plays here. However, there are some complaints about the price switch and slow play. Despite these concerns, the staff quality and friendliness are praised as excellent. The value for the money is generally good, and the facility quality is rated as average to excellent. The course difficulty varies, but golfers overall find it enjoyable and moderately challenging.
Good to know
Golfers tell us that the restroom facilities at the golf course are severely worn and emit an unpleasant odor. Some reviewers felt that the standard of the restroom facilities is below what would be expected for a golf course of this caliber. Additionally, some golfers experienced stalling with the carts during their rounds and suggested that they need maintenance or replacement. Slow play was also mentioned as an issue by a few reviewers, who suggested that slower players should allow faster players to play through. Furthermore, some golfers were frustrated by the lack of effort by other players to repair ball marks on the greens, and would appreciate an initiative to encourage golfers to repair ball marks.
